  • Forward May 30, 2003
    This piece is meant to promote a positive message,' the 27-year-old Bekerman told the Forward. 'There is a lot commonality among cultures -- we are not so different. We have different food, music, the way we dress and speak -- the outside parts of our cultures are very diverse. But when you come down to it, there is a lot of commonality, and that's what this work is all about.'

  • Queens Chronicle - May 29, 2003 ...While in the past her pieces have been quite conceptual--one took place in front of an aquatic pile driver--her most recent work is a departure toward the narrative. Titled 'A Goyish Affair With A Twist,' the semi-autobiographical work tells the story of a Russian Jewish-Latino wedding in NYC rife with family struggles and cultural humor
